About Steven L. Taylor

Steven L. Taylor is a Professor of Political Science and a College of Arts and Sciences Dean. His main areas of expertise include parties, elections, and the institutional design of democracies. His most recent book is the co-authored A Different Democracy: American Government in a 31-Country Perspective. He earned his Ph.D. from the University of Texas and his BA from the University of California, Irvine. He has been blogging since 2003 (originally at the now defunct Poliblog). Texas lands Wake Forest transfer DB Gavin Holmes

Back on Dec. 1, Wake Forest sophomore cornerback Gavin Holmes elected to enter the transfer portal. Today, he announced his decision to commit to the University of Texas after an official visit to Austin last weekend.

Holmes has proven to be a hot commodity in the transfer portal, totaling nearly 20 offers from the likes of Ole Miss, Washington, Arkansas, Mississippi State, Texas, among others.
